It was a proper cat-fight when Wright City faced off against Soldan International Studies on Wednesday. The Wildcats lost 6-2 to the Tigers. That's two games in a row now that Wright City have lost by exactly four goals.
Wright City's loss dropped their record down to 0-4. As for Soldan International Studies, they now have a winning record of 2-1.
Coincidentally, Wright City and Soldan International Studies will both be playing Warrenton the next time they take the pitch. The Tigers will host the Warriors on Thursday, while the Wildcats will head out to face them at 11:30 a.m. on Saturday.
